How to Choose the Perfect Domain Name for Your Business

Choosing the perfect domain name for your business is an important decision that can have a lasting impact on the success of your venture. A good domain name should be easy to remember, accurately reflect your brand, and be available for registration. Here are some tips to help you select the ideal domain name for your business:

1. Brainstorm: Start by brainstorming potential domain names that accurately reflect your brand. Consider words or phrases that are related to your business, such as its mission, values, or services.

2. Research Availability: Once you’ve identified potential domain names, research their availability. You can use a domain name search tool to quickly check if the domain name is available for registration.

3. Keep It Short: Aim for a domain name that is short and memorable. Longer domain names are more difficult to remember and type into a web browser.

4. Avoid Hyphens and Numbers: Try to avoid using hyphens or numbers in your domain name, as they can make it harder to remember and type correctly.

5. Choose the Right Extension: The most common domain extensions are .com, .net, and .org. However, there are many other options available, such as .biz, .info, and .co. Consider which extension best suits your business.

By following these tips, you can choose the perfect domain name for your business. With the right domain name, you can create a strong online presence and attract more customers.

How to Protect Your Domain Name from Cyber Squatters

Cyber squatting is a growing problem for domain name owners. These individuals register domain names similar to existing ones to profit from the confusion. Protecting your domain name from cyber squatters requires vigilance and action. Here’s what you can do:

1. Register Early

Don’t wait! Register your domain name as soon as possible. This reduces the risk of someone else snagging a similar domain name before you do.

2. Register Multiple Versions

Consider registering various versions of your domain name, such as .com, .net, and .org. This makes it challenging for others to grab a similar name with a different extension.

3. Monitor Availability

Regularly check the availability of your domain name. This helps you identify any attempts to register a similar one quickly. If you spot any, contact the registrant and request a transfer.

4. Use a Monitoring Service

Consider using a domain name monitoring service. These services keep an eye on your domain name’s availability and alert you to potential threats. It’s a proactive way to safeguard your brand.

5. File a Complaint

If all else fails, consider filing a complaint with the Internet Corporation for Assigned Names and Numbers (ICANN). They oversee domain names and can take action against cyber squatters.

By following these steps, you can protect your domain name and keep your brand secure. Now, let’s delve into another critical decision – whether to buy an existing domain name or not:

How to Research a Domain Name Before You Buy It

Before you click that “buy” button, it’s crucial to thoroughly research your chosen domain name. Here’s how you can do it:

1. Check Availability

Begin by checking the availability of your desired domain name using a domain name search tool. This will tell you if the name is available and if any alternative extensions are up for grabs.

2. Research Trademarks

Investigate whether there are any trademarks associated with the domain name. If it’s trademarked, using it without permission could lead to legal trouble.

3. Check Social Media

Take a tour of social media platforms to see if your domain name is already in use. If it is, it might be challenging to establish your presence on those platforms.

4. Analyze Competitors

Study your competitors’ domain names. This can provide valuable insights into effective naming strategies and help you differentiate yourself.

By conducting thorough research, you can ensure that the domain name you choose is a perfect fit for your business.
